Unlocking the Server-Status Apache 404 Code: Advantages and Disadvantages

The Importance and Relevance of Server-Status Apache 404

As the world’s most popular web server software, Apache is relied on by millions of websites around the world. At the heart of Apache is a complex system of codes and configurations that make it possible to deliver seamless and high-quality web experiences to users. The discovery of the server-status apache 404 code has been a revelation for web developers, IT professionals, and businesses alike, allowing them to unlock a wealth of information about their web servers and make better decisions about how to optimize their performance.

In this article, we will delve deeper into the server-status apache 404 code, examining its many advantages as well as its potential drawbacks. We will look at how it helps developers to identify and troubleshoot issues on web servers, how it can improve website performance and reduce downtime, and how it can be used to enhance the overall user experience. Along the way, we will also explore some of the challenges and limitations associated with using server-status apache 404, as well as some best practices for overcoming them.

The Basics of Server-Status Apache 404

Before we dive into the advantages and disadvantages of server-status apache 404, it’s important to understand what it is and how it works. Essentially, server-status apache 404 is a special code that is generated by the Apache web server software whenever a client requests a resource that does not exist. This could be due to a broken link, a mistyped URL, or any number of other factors.

Instead of simply displaying a generic error message to the user, Apache generates a 404 error code along with a detailed error page that provides information about the server’s current status. This can include details about the server load, the number of active connections, the uptime, and various other metrics that can be valuable to web developers and IT professionals.

The Advantages of Server-Status Apache 404

Identifying and Troubleshooting Issues

One of the biggest advantages of server-status apache 404 is its ability to help developers identify and troubleshoot issues on web servers. By providing detailed information about the server’s status, developers can quickly pinpoint any bottlenecks, errors, or other issues that may be affecting website performance. This can lead to faster and more accurate troubleshooting, which in turn can help to minimize website downtime and improve the overall user experience.

Improving Website Performance

Another key advantage of server-status apache 404 is its potential to improve website performance. By providing real-time information about the server’s load and other metrics, developers can make more informed decisions about how to optimize their websites for maximum speed and efficiency. This might involve changing certain configurations or settings, upgrading hardware or software, or implementing other strategies to reduce latency and improve responsiveness.

Enhancing the User Experience

Finally, server-status apache 404 can be a valuable tool for enhancing the overall user experience. By providing a more detailed and informative error page, developers can help users understand why they’re seeing an error and provide suggestions for how to resolve it. This can reduce frustration and improve user retention, which is critical for businesses that rely on their websites for revenue and customer engagement.

The Disadvantages of Server-Status Apache 404

Security Concerns

Although server-status apache 404 can be a powerful tool for web development and IT management, it does come with some potential drawbacks. One of the most significant of these is security. Because server-status apache 404 provides such detailed information about the server and its status, it can also be a potential security vulnerability. If unauthorized users are able to access this information, they may be able to use it to launch attacks or exploit vulnerabilities in the server or its applications.

Complexity and Technical Expertise

Another potential disadvantage of server-status apache 404 is its complexity. Because it relies on a complex system of codes and configurations, it can be difficult for non-technical users to understand and use effectively. This means that businesses and organizations may need to invest in specialized training or hire dedicated IT staff to manage their servers and make the most of the server-status apache 404 code.

The Server-Status Apache 404 Table

Variable
Description
ServerName
The hostname of the server
ServerVersion
The version of the Apache server software
ServerMPM
The multi-processing module used by the server
ServerBuilt
The date and time when the server was built
Uptime
The total uptime of the server since it was started
LoadAverage
The current load average of the server, measured over the last 1, 5, and 15 minutes
TotalAccesses
The total number of server processes that have been processed since the server was started
TotalKBytes
The total number of kilobytes served since the server was started
CPULoad
The current CPU load of the server, measured as a percentage of its total capacity
BytesPerReq
The average number of bytes per request processed by the server
BytesPerSec
The average number of bytes per second served by the server
BusyWorkers
The number of server processes that are currently active and processing requests
IdleWorkers
The number of server processes that are currently idle and waiting for requests
READ ALSO  Apache Simple File Server Config: Fast and Reliable

Frequently Asked Questions

What is server-status?

Server-status is a special code generated by the Apache web server software that provides information about the server’s status, including its uptime, load, and other relevant metrics.

What is a 404 error?

A 404 error is an HTTP status code that indicates that the client was able to communicate with the server, but the server was unable to find the requested resource.

What causes a 404 error?

A 404 error can be caused by many different factors, including broken links, mistyped URLs, deleted files or directories, and other issues related to the server or the client.

How can server-status apache 404 be used to improve website performance?

By providing real-time information about the server’s load and other metrics, developers can make more informed decisions about how to optimize their websites for maximum speed and efficiency. This might involve changing certain configurations or settings, upgrading hardware or software, or implementing other strategies to reduce latency and improve responsiveness.

What are some potential drawbacks of using server-status apache 404?

Some potential drawbacks of server-status apache 404 include security concerns, complexity, and the need for technical expertise to use it effectively.

What is an example of when server-status apache 404 would be useful?

Server-status apache 404 might be useful if a website is experiencing slow load times or other performance issues, as it can help developers identify and troubleshoot the underlying causes of these problems.

Can server-status apache 404 be used with other web server software?

Server-status apache 404 is specifically designed to work with the Apache web server software and may not be compatible or available with other web server software.

What are some best practices for using server-status apache 404?

Some best practices for using server-status apache 404 include limiting access to authorized users only, regularly monitoring and reviewing server logs, and keeping software and security updates up-to-date.

What is the difference between server-status and server-info?

Server-info is another special code generated by Apache that provides more detailed information about the server’s configuration and modules, while server-status specifically focuses on the server’s status and metrics.

Is server-status apache 404 compatible with all versions of Apache?

Server-status apache 404 is generally compatible with most versions of Apache, but there may be some differences or limitations depending on the specific version and configuration of the server.

Is server-status apache 404 easy to use?

Server-status apache 404 can be complex and may require technical expertise to use effectively, but there are many resources available online to help users get started and make the most of this powerful tool.

Does server-status apache 404 work with all types of websites?

Server-status apache 404 is generally compatible with most types of websites, but there may be some differences or limitations depending on the specific configuration and requirements of the website.

What is the best way to learn how to use server-status apache 404?

The best way to learn how to use server-status apache 404 is to consult the Apache documentation and seek out resources and tutorials online. It may also be helpful to work with experienced web developers or IT professionals who have experience using this tool in real-world settings.

How can server-status apache 404 be used to enhance the user experience?

By providing a more detailed and informative error page, developers can help users understand why they’re seeing an error and provide suggestions for how to resolve it. This can reduce frustration and improve user retention, which is critical for businesses that rely on their websites for revenue and customer engagement.

READ ALSO  Apache Server is Not Working: Causes, Solutions and FAQs

What are some common mistakes or pitfalls to avoid when using server-status apache 404?

Some common mistakes or pitfalls to avoid when using server-status apache 404 include failing to limit access to authorized users only, not monitoring server logs regularly, and neglecting to keep software and security updates up-to-date.

Conclusion

In conclusion, server-status apache 404 is a powerful and valuable tool for web developers and IT professionals looking to optimize the performance of their web servers. By providing real-time information about the server’s status, it can help users identify and troubleshoot issues more quickly and make more informed decisions about how to improve website performance and enhance the user experience. However, it is important to keep in mind that server-status apache 404 does come with some potential drawbacks and challenges, including security concerns and the need for technical expertise. To make the most of this powerful tool, businesses and organizations should invest in specialized training and work with experienced professionals to ensure that they are using it effectively and safely.

Thanks for reading, and we hope you found this article helpful in understanding the advantages and disadvantages of server-status apache 404!

Closing Disclaimer

This article is for informational purposes only and should not be construed as legal or professional advice. We make no representations or warranties of any kind, express or implied, about the completeness, accuracy, reliability, suitability, or availability with respect to the article or the information, products, services, or related graphics contained in the article for any purpose. Any reliance you place on such information is therefore strictly at your own risk.

In no event will we be liable for any loss or damage including without limitation, indirect or consequential loss or damage, or any loss or damage whatsoever arising from loss of data or profits arising out of, or in connection with, the use of this article.

Video:Unlocking the Server-Status Apache 404 Code: Advantages and Disadvantages